Get a diagnosis through the NHS or pay for a private exam

The NHS might be the best alternative if you're searching for an accurate diagnosis of ADHD. But, you'll need check what's available and consider your own options.

The UK government has published a guideline for those who wish to learn more about the process. It provides a brief history of the issue as well as tips to get over funding concerns.

Private healthcare is an option if you are not able wait 18 weeks to receive an appointment. Private mental health services can be less expensive, quicker and provide a more complete diagnosis.

You can find a lot of providers offering the service through a quick internet search. Some even provide online testing. Others will require a referral from your GP.

Finding a diagnosis through the NHS can be challenging. The NHS provides only 120,000 diagnoses per year , which means it can be difficult to obtain one. Based on the provider you select for your private diagnosis, it can cost between PS300 to PS800.

Private psychiatrists can offer a more thorough diagnosis than a general physician in some instances. This is a positive thing. They can also test for any other ailments that could affect treatment.

ADHD is often a cause of excessive impulsivity or hyperactivity among children. ADHD can also lead to problems in relationships and school performance. The condition can be treated by a an array of treatments.

If your child suffers from ADHD A behavioral therapist can work with you to establish a treatment plan that reduces behaviors that are associated with the condition. You may need to see the therapist many times to experience the full benefit of the treatment.

It is possible that the treatment your child receives isn't working when you first start it. This is because a child's symptoms can vary from day to day. The process of behavioral therapy requires time and patience, but it is an effective form of treatment.

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der. It is not a personality trait. Children with this disorder might be trouble sitting still or losing their focus in conversations, and struggle to finish homework. ADHD can also lead to problems with sleep, hearing, and thyroid issues, aswell in learning disabilities.

Depending on the diagnosis, your child might be eligible to receive an IEP or 504 plan under the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act. However, eligibility determinations are not the same across school districts.
